The ads popup constantly while using my phone (dozens of times a day). They even popup and play during a phone call! They are not limited to while browsing in Chrome or limited to certain apps. They appear during all types of app and phone usage. I cannot 'x' out or back out of them. I have to wait for them to finish playing. I've downloaded three malware scan apps (Malwarebytes Anti-Malware by Malwarebytes, Ad Blocker & Notification by Upfront Applicatons, and Airpush Detector by Dan Bjorge). All report the phone is free of malware. I completely wiped the phone (factory data reset) and re set it up and instantly the ads continued!? I even deleted all apps except core Motorola and AT&T apps. But the ads continued. My phone is a non-rooted first generation Moto X running Android version 4.4.4. The ads are varied including companies such as for Citrix Go-To Meeting, Hotels.com, Game of War, Penzoil, etc.
Any help or advice is greatly appreciated! Thank you!
 
Welcome to Android Central! Do another factory reset, but this time, before you do it, go to Settings>Backup & Reset, and uncheck Automatically Restore. After the reset is done and you've gone through the Setup Wizard, go immediately to Google Play Store and stop any app that might be installing automatically. Now see if the problem persists.
 
:) Thank you! Your instructions worked. It was something in the Automatically Restore that must have re-loaded the problem as I did not do that step when I tried on my own the first time. I've been slowly adding apps one at a time over the last couple days and the phone works again without the interruptions.
